Some tips for your application 🫡
Understand the Role: Take the time to thoroughly understand the responsibilities and expectations of a Business Development Representative. This will help you tailor your application to highlight relevant skills and experiences.
Craft a Compelling Cover Letter: Write a cover letter that showcases your passion for business development and your understanding of the company's mission. Use specific examples from your past experiences to demonstrate how you can contribute to their goals.
Highlight Relevant Skills: In your CV, emphasize skills that are crucial for a Business Development Representative, such as communication, negotiation, and analytical skills. Make sure to provide concrete examples of how you've successfully used these skills in previous roles.
Follow Up: After submitting your application, consider sending a polite follow-up email to express your continued interest in the position. This shows initiative and can help keep your application top of mind.
How to prepare for a job interview at IrishJobs
✨Know the Company Inside Out
Before your interview, make sure to research the company thoroughly. Understand their products, services, and market position. This will help you tailor your answers and show genuine interest.
✨Prepare Your Success Stories
Think of specific examples from your past experiences that demonstrate your skills in business development.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your responses effectively.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ions to ask the interviewer about the company's growth strategies and challenges. This shows that you are proactive and genuinely interested in contributing to their success.
✨Showcase Your Communication Skills
As a Business Development Representative, strong communication is key. Practice articulating your thoughts clearly and confidently during the interview to leave a lasting impression.
